AI Japanese Punk Hip-Hop Poster Side-by-Side Comparison AI Image Prompt

Prompt

Goal: Create a side-by-side comparison graphic showing two AI-generated Japanese punk/hip-hop magazine posters, with the left panel labeled {argument name="left model label" default="GPT Image 2.0"} and the right panel labeled {argument name="right model label" default="GPT Image 2.5"}. The image should feel like a dramatic test comparing an older image model with a newer, more realistic one. Canvas: Wide horizontal 3:2 composition, black header bar across the top, two equal vertical poster panels below separated by a thin divider. Use gritty off-white newsprint paper texture, black ink, distressed red accents, and high-contrast editorial poster design. Layout: There are exactly 2 poster panels. Panel 1 on the left shows a Japanese male vocalist photographed from the waist up, slightly lower realism, holding a black microphone near his mouth with one hand and reaching toward the viewer with the other. Panel 2 on the right shows the same concept with stronger realism and more cinematic depth: a Japanese male vocalist in a black leather jacket, intense facial expression, microphone at his mouth, hand thrust toward the camera with strong perspective blur. Add small subtitle text under the right header reading "Sunburst". Main subject: In each panel, depict exactly 1 male singer, for a total of 2 singers. He has short dark hair, a sweaty intense performance expression, a black leather jacket over a dark shirt, silver rings, and a handheld black microphone. The pose is aggressive and immersive, as if shouting lyrics directly at the viewer on stage. Text and typography: Fill both posters with oversized Japanese editorial typography. Use exactly 6 major visible Japanese slogan elements repeated across the layout: 1) huge black headline across the top reading {argument name="main Japanese headline" default="黙ってた分、"}, 2) black phrase "限界より先に、俺がいる。", 3) red phrase "正解よりでかい、この声。", 4) large red vertical word "衝動", 5) large black/red vertical word "轟音", 6) enormous red bottom headline {argument name="bottom Japanese headline" default="音になれ。"}. Surround these with many tiny Japanese body-copy columns, notes, arrows, and thin dividing rules like a dense music magazine layout; the tiny text does not need to be readable but should look typographically authentic. Visual style: Japanese underground music poster, punk zine, brutalist typography, photocopied paper grain, ink bleed, distressed halftone, red paint splatters, torn-print imperfections, cinematic concert photography, shallow depth of field especially on the right panel. Left panel should look flatter and less lifelike; right panel should look more realistic, dimensional, and visceral. Color palette: off-white paper, deep black, crimson red, subtle gray shadows, skin tones, glossy black leather highlights. Constraints: Keep the two-panel comparison structure clear. Do not add extra singers, extra panels, logos, watermarks, or English body text beyond the two model labels and the small "Sunburst" subtitle. Preserve the Japanese slogans as visible poster text.

AI Image Content Analysis

Content: Structure: 3:2 wide two-panel side-by-side comparison, black header bar with thin divider; one half-body male Japanese vocalist per panel holding a mic and reaching at camera; six oversized Japanese slogans plus dense small-type layout; punk zine, brutalist, photocopy grain, halftone distress, shallow depth of field; off-white/black/crimson palette; stresses left-right realism gap.

Pros: Layout, typography, style, palette and constraints are specific, countable and easy to swap via variables.

Cons: Very dense elements risk garbled or wrong text; the realism gap depends on the model and needs many tries.
